    If that link doesn’t work… In 1970 an 8 ton dead gray whale washed up on the beach in Florence.

    Now, in Oregon, all the beaches are public beaches, under the control of the highway department, and they didn’t know how to remove a dead whale.

    So they packed it with 1/2 a ton of dynamite and blew it up thinking the seagulls and crabs would eat the bits remaining.

        History on the Oregon law here, passed in 3 B.W. (before whale).

        https://www.opb.org/news/article/history-oregon-tom-mccall-public-beaches/

        While California has public beaches, they have private beaches as well. In Oregon the entire coastline is public.

        https://www.californiabeaches.com/california-state-beaches/

        Looks like WA is the same, public/private mix.
